3

ActiveMQインスタンスをセットアップしていて、ミラーリングされたキューを使用して特定のキューを時々監視することに興味があります。ただし、リンクされたドキュメントから、ミラーリングされたキューを有効にすると、システム内のすべてのキューにミラートピックが作成され、その多くが存在するようです。このアプローチについていくつか質問があります。

  1. サブスクライバーがいないトピックがあると、パフォーマンスに大きな影響がありますか?このトピックには常にチャンネル登録者がいるとは限りません。誰も聞いていないときの影響が最小限になることを願っています。
  2. キューのパフォーマンスは、監視トピックよりも明らかに重要です。ミラートピックのサブスクライバーのみが耐久性がない場合、追加のシステム負荷を最小限に抑えるのに役立ちますか?

ありがとう!

4

1 に答える 1

0

通常、誰もトピックを購読していない場合、大きな問題はありません。そして、はい、耐久性のない加入者は一般的に反対よりも安いです。ただし、VisualVMを特定のセットアップに接続し、ミラーリングされたキューがある場合とない場合の負荷時のリソース使用量を監視することをお勧めします。それはおそらくこの質問に対する最良の答えを与えるでしょう

于 2013-02-26T20:42:33.947 に答える